Original Air Date: 7/15/2016
Alfred Knapp, known as the “Hamilton Strangler”, left a trail of dead young women through Southern Ohio in the 1890s and early 1900s. My guest, Richard O Jones, the host of the True Crime Historian podcast, and author of The First Celebrity Serial Killer in Southwest Ohio: The Confessions of the Strangler Alfred Knapp, tells the story of the life and death of this notorious killer.
